Jools Holland has announced that the critically acclaimed singer and songwriter Marc Almond will join him on stage when he performs at Middlesbrough Town Hall on Wednesday 14 May 2008.
Marc first came to the public's attention as one half of the electro duo Soft Cell in the early 1980s; their biggest hit, Tainted Love, was number one all over the world and is in the Guinness Book of Records as spending the longest time in the U.S. Top 100. Marc re-recorded his song Say Hello Wave Goodbye with Jools in 2001 for the platinum-selling Friends album.
Returning to the Town Hall after over 10 years Jools Holland and his Rhythm & Blues Orchestra will take to the main stage on Wednesday 14 May 2008 at 8.00pm.
The sensational pianist and front man will perform with his 18-piece Rhythm and Blues Orchestra featuring drummer Gilson Lavis (ex Squeeze Drummer) and the magnificent guest soloists Ruby Turner and Louise Marshall.

Later...with Jools Holland has now gone live every Tuesday night bringing a varied programme of new and established artists and legends. Touring all over the country and Europe Jools and his Rhythm and Blues Orchestra now play to audiences in excess of 500,000. All musicians in the band are professional session musicians who are recognised in their own right.
